Follower Plates for Lubrication Technology: Stable System Integration and Air-Free Media Extraction

In industrial lubricant delivery, the follower plate is the decisive component for reliable media extraction from original containers. When delivering high-viscosity greases (up to NLGI class 3), there is a risk without a follower plate that the pump will draw a funnel into the medium (tunneling or cratering). This leads to the suction of air, resulting in cavitation within the pump mechanism and process interruptions in the dispensing chain. ABNOX follower plates eliminate this risk through vacuum-assisted tracking of the medium.

Functional Principle and Technical Relevance

The follower plate rests directly on the surface of the lubricant. Due to the vacuum created during the pump's suction process, the plate is pressed downwards by atmospheric pressure. This mechanical pressure ensures that the medium is continuously pushed into the suction tube of the delivery pump without air inclusions. Furthermore, the plate serves as a protective barrier against oxidation and the ingress of ambient contaminants.
 

Product Specification

Manufactured from robust materials for use in standard containers (e.g., 5 kg to 200 kg). The circumferential, elastic sealing lip is chemically resistant to common industrial lubricants and cleanly wipes the container wall as it descends. This reduces the residual quantity in the container to a minimum and optimizes material utilization. Central openings are precisely matched to the suction tube diameters of ABNOX delivery pumps to ensure a hermetic seal at the interface.

Design Features and Material Quality

  • Sealing Lip Geometry: 
    The flexible edge seal compensates for slight deformations in metal or plastic containers and guarantees a constant vacuum.
  • Base Plate Stability: 
    Solid construction to prevent deformation when handling high viscosities and powerful suction capacities.
  • Bleeding Mechanism: 
    Integrated bleed valves or ports allow for easy placement of the plate onto a full container as well as trouble-free removal after emptying.
  • Wear Resistance: 
    Use of high-performance elastomers (e.g., NBR), which offer a long service life even with frequent container changes and contact with abrasive media.

Process Reliability through Optimized Media Guidance

The use of ABNOX follower plates is a fundamental prerequisite for the automated continuous operation of lubrication and dispensing systems. By completely evacuating air from the suction area, a constant compressibility of the media column is ensured. This leads to high repeatability of the dispensing cycles and protects the system from uncontrolled pressure fluctuations. Furthermore, the clean wiping of the inner container walls reduces operating costs by maximizing the utilization of the available lubricant.
